Regelbau 621 Quarter
 
The regelbau 621 which was built here had registration-number 5754. Special of this bunker are the two protection-walls, which had to stop splitter from exploding bombs. Usually these walls were not constructed as here was done.

Tobruk with tunnel to quarter
 
The most right picture gives a good view of the tobruk. You can see some steps up to a higher level. On this tobruk there used to be a tank-turret. This can be concluded from the steel plate on top of the tobruk. 

The picture on the left shows how the tunnel (coverd trench) is connected to the tobruk.

In the tunnel between the tobruk and a quarter there was an emergency exit. See the picture below.

Storage
 
A small T-shaped tunnel was probably used as storage. The tunnel was very high, about three metres and was constructed from stone in stet of concrete.
